Re: Heat Pump temp defferntial
Nope. Heat pumps operate under such a wide range of temperatures, there is no "normal" temperature split.
Now, having said that, I look for about 20 degrees as a starting place, but just because it achieves or exceeds that does not mean it is working correctly.
